Victory Junction refreshes Iconic “Timken Tunnel” and Enhances Campus Lighting
For more than 20 years, The Timken Tunnel at Victory Junction has served as a gateway to the heart of Camp, and thanks to the generous support of The Timken Foundation and Musco Lighting, the iconic landmark and surrounding campus have received significant enhancements designed to improve the camper and family experience.

The enhanced tunnel now features refreshed signage, including a new vibrantly checkered “The Timken Tunnel” entrance sign and large “Welcome Campers” lettering above the tunnel entrance. As children and families leave Camp, they now see a playful “See Ya Later!” message on the opposite side.
Musco Lighting transformed the tunnel with interior and exterior lighting capable of illuminating the space in multiple colors, creating a dynamic and immersive welcome for campers and families.
In addition to the tunnel enhancements, The Timken Foundation’s support allowed Victory Junction to upgrade lighting across campus. Additional upgrades include replacing existing indoor and outdoor lighting with energy-efficient solutions and installing new lighting in previously unlit outdoor areas to improve visibility and safety. These improvements will help create a safer, more welcoming environment for campers, families, volunteers, and visitors while supporting the Camp’s long-term sustainability efforts.
“For generations of campers and families, The Timken Tunnel has marked the location where anticipation turns into reality as they enter Camp,” said Chad Coltrane, President and Chief Executive Officer for Victory Junction. “We’re incredibly grateful to the Timken Foundation and Musco for helping refresh this iconic feature while also enhancing our campus environment through important lighting improvements that will benefit the children and families we serve for years to come.”
The tunnel reflects Victory Junction’s deep NASCAR roots and racing-inspired campus. Founded by the Petty family in honor of Adam Petty, Victory Junction was created to provide a medically safe, empowering environment where children living with complex medical and physical needs can experience the fun and freedom of Camp – always free of charge to families thanks to the generosity of donors and partners.

About Victory Junction
Victory Junction is a year-round camp for children living with complex medical and physical conditions. Founded by Kyle Petty and family in honor of his son Adam, Victory Junction provides life-changing experiences that are exciting, fun and empowering in a medically safe environment – always free of charge, thanks to the generosity of donors and corporate partners. Victory Junction programming is designed to build confidence and foster independence, helping children, families, and caregivers find belonging and build skills that fuel their journeys far beyond Camp. In addition to onsite sessions, Victory Junction’s OUTREACH program delivers Camp experiences to children in hospitals, clinics, and community partner sites throughout the Carolinas and Virginia. Since opening in 2004, Victory Junction has provided more than 150,000 experiences to children from all 50 states, Washington, D.C., Puerto Rico, and four countries. Victory Junction is a member of the SeriousFun Children’s Network, founded by Paul Newman, and is accredited by the American Camp Association. To learn more, please visit victoryjunction.org.
